-/**
- * SG_Spatial contains spatial information (local & world position, rotation
- * and scaling) for a Scene graph node.
- * It also contains a link to the node's parent.
- */
-class SG_Spatial : public SG_IObject
-{
-
-protected:
- MT_Point3 m_localPosition;
- MT_Matrix3x3 m_localRotation;
- MT_Vector3 m_localScaling;
-
- MT_Point3 m_worldPosition;
- MT_Matrix3x3 m_worldRotation;
- MT_Vector3 m_worldScaling;
-
- SG_ParentRelation * m_parent_relation;
-
- SG_BBox m_bbox;
- MT_Scalar m_radius;
- bool m_modified;
- bool m_ogldirty; // true if the openGL matrix for this object must be recomputed
-
-public:
- inline void ClearModified()
- {
- m_modified = false;
- m_ogldirty = true;
- }
- inline void SetModified()
- {
- m_modified = true;
- ActivateScheduleUpdateCallback();
- }
- inline void ClearDirty()
- {
- m_ogldirty = false;
- }
- /**
- * Define the relationship this node has with it's parent
- * node. You should pass an unshared instance of an SG_ParentRelation
- * allocated on the heap to this method. Ownership of this
- * instance is assumed by this class.
- * You may call this function several times in the lifetime
- * of a node to change the relationship dynamically.
- * You must call this method before the first call to UpdateSpatialData().
- * An assertion will be fired at run-time in debug if this is not
- * the case.
- * The relation is activated only if no controllers of this object
- * updated the coordinates of the child.
- */
-
- void
- SetParentRelation(
- SG_ParentRelation *relation
- );
-
- SG_ParentRelation * GetParentRelation()
- {
- return m_parent_relation;
- }
-
-
-
-
- /**
- * Apply a translation relative to the current position.
- * if local then the translation is assumed to be in the
- * local coordinates of this object. If not then the translation
- * is assumed to be in global coordinates. In this case
- * you must provide a pointer to the parent of this object if it
- * exists otherwise if there is no parent set it to NULL
- */
-
- void
- RelativeTranslate(
- const MT_Vector3& trans,
- const SG_Spatial *parent,
- bool local
- );
